Why millions of people around the world will contract measles in 2026

The World Health Organization estimates nearly 11 million people will contract measles in 2026, concentrated in Africa and Asia but with outbreaks also reported across Europe and the Americas.

Herd immunity requires vaccination rates above 95%, a threshold most high-income countries meet but many low- and middle-income nations fall well short of, partly due to pandemic-era disruptions that left millions of children with zero doses.

Bangladesh has reported the most cases and over 900 deaths this year, a crisis worsened by a botched attempt to bypass UNICEF procurement and by funding cuts to Gavi, the vaccine alliance, after the U.S. and several European nations reduced development aid budgets.
